Step-by-Step Guide to Applying Durable Epoxy Resin Coatings

Hey there! If you're looking to give your surfaces a real makeover, applying durable epoxy resin coatings is the way to go. They not only enhance performance but also look fantastic! First things first, make sure your surface is squeaky clean and totally free from any nasties. Grab a suitable cleaner to wipe off any grease or dirt—trust me, it makes a difference! And don’t forget to give it a light sand to help that epoxy stick like it should.

Innovative Solutions for Durable and High-Performance Epoxy Resin Coating

Once you're all set, mix up your epoxy resin following the manufacturer's guidelines. Pay close attention to get that right mix of resin and hardener; it’s super important! Now, when you’re ready, pour the epoxy onto the surface and spread it out evenly using a trowel or a roller. A little tip? Apply the mixture in thin layers to avoid any pesky bubbles. If bubbles do show up, you can gently use a heat source or torch to coax them out.

Let your first layer cure completely before you go ahead and add more coats, if needed. This way, you’ll ensure that your finish is tough and durable. Just remember to cure everything in a stable environment where it’s not too humid or hot—this helps you get the best results possible. With a bit of care and attention to detail, you’ll end up with a gorgeous, long-lasting epoxy finish that’ll really impress!

Troubleshooting Common Issues in Epoxy Coating Applications

So, let's talk about epoxy resin coatings. You know, when you're working with them, a few hiccups can pop up that might mess with how durable or good-looking the final result turns out. One of the usual suspects is those pesky bubbles that can form while the resin cures. This often happens because of not mixing things properly or maybe there’s a bit too much moisture in the air. To tackle this, just make sure you're mixing the resin and hardener really well and sticking to the right ratio. Oh, and try to keep the humidity levels down a bit; that’ll really help with a smoother application and cut down on any bubbling or premature curing.

Then there's yellowing, which happens when your beautiful finish gets hit with UV rays over time. To fight this off, think about tossing in some UV-resistant additives into your mix. Also, slapping on a good quality topcoat can give you that extra shield against the sun. If you see that yellowing has already snuck in, don’t freak out! Just give the surface a light sanding and throw on a fresh coat, and you should be good to go. By staying ahead of these issues and using reliable materials that are built to last, you can totally nail that stunning, long-lasting epoxy finish.

Maximizing Adhesive Performance: The Essential Role of C9 Hydrocarbon Resin

Maximizing Adhesive Performance: The Essential Role of C9 Hydrocarbon Resin

C9 Hydrocarbon Resin, derived from the C9 fraction by-products of petroleum cracking, plays a critical role in enhancing adhesive formulations. With a molecular weight range of 300 to 3000, this thermoplastic resin is not classified as a high polymer. Instead, it serves as a low-cost additive that significantly improves the viscosity and compatibility of adhesives, making them more effective for a variety of applications. According to a recent industry report from MarketsandMarkets, the increasing demand for efficient adhesives in automotive, construction, and packaging sectors has propelled the growth of resin applications, highlighting the indispensable role of C9 Hydrocarbon Resin.

The effectiveness of C9 Hydrocarbon Resin lies in its ability to modify adhesion properties. By promoting better wetting and spreadability, it enhances the overall bonding strength of adhesives, which is crucial for applications requiring durability and longevity. The versatility of C9 resins allows them to be used in hot melt adhesives, pressure-sensitive adhesives, and even in sealants. A report from Technavio indicates that the global hot melt adhesive market is expected to grow by USD 3.75 billion from 2021 to 2025, underlining the increasing reliance on advanced materials like C9 Hydrocarbon Resin to meet industry demands. With its unique characteristics and proven performance, C9 Hydrocarbon Resin continues to be a vital ingredient in the formulation of high-performance adhesives.
